California Symphony will celebrate spring with the World Premiere of Katherine Balchs "Illuminate," the centerpiece of a program titled "French Impressions."Mezzo-soprano Kelly Guerra and sopranos Molly Netter and Alexandra Smither will perform this new work by Balch, who was California Symphonys Young American Composer-in-Residence from 2017-2020 and was scheduled to present this World Premiere in March 2020, postponed due to COVID. Incorporating text from "Les Illuminations" by French poet Rimbaud, blended with works by Balchs other favorite poets, "Illuminate" offers a celebration of friendship and joy from the female perspective over the course of five movements via a framework of the cycle of the seasons, beginning and ending with the spring.The program will also present British composer Thomas Ads homage to Couperin, the French baroque composer who served as Louis XIVs organist in Versailles, in "Three Studies After Couperin," an arrangement of three harpsichord pieces that recall the masters ability to sketch nimble personal portraits with his keyboard. "French Impressions" will also include works by the two leading French impressionist composers, Debussys "Danse" and Ravels "Ma mre lOye (Mother Goose)," displaying their lighter sides with these lively selections.SHOWS:7:30pm, March 26 Saturday4:00pm, March 27 Sunday
